SELECT COALESCE(\'abc\',\'\') -- 返回 abc SELECT COALESCE(NULL,\'\') -- 返回 空字符串http://SELECT COALESCE(null,null,\'123\',\'abc\') -- 返回 123PS:这个函数是返回第一个非空的值,所以参数里面必须最少有一个非空的值 。
29、ISNull():判断指定的表达式一是否为空(null),如果为空则返回表达式二的值,否则返回表达式一的值 , 类似于C#中的三元运算符 。该方法有两个参数:
参数1:指定要操作的表达式一 。
参数2:指定要操作的表达式二 。
select isnull(\'\',\'123\') -- 返回 空字符串 select isnull(null,\'123\') -- 返回 123 select isnull(\'123\',\'abc\') -- 返回 123 select isnull(null,null) -- 返回 null30、Convert():数据类型转换 。该方法有三个参数:
参数1:指定要转换后的数据类型 。
参数2:指定要转换的表达式,可以是字段或表达式
参数3:转换后的格式,如日期型转换后有很多种格式,yyyy/mm/dd 等,这个参数可以省略 。
CONVERT(varchar(10),\'1,2,3,\') --返回 \'1\',\'2\',\'3\'还有就是这我总结出了一些架构视频资料和互联网公司java程序员面试涉及到的绝大部分面试题和答案做成了文档和架构视频资料还有完整高清的java进阶架构学习思维导图免费分享给大家(包括Dubbo、Redis、Netty、zookeeper、Spring cloud、分布式、高并发等架构技术资料) , 希望能帮助到您面试前的复习且找到一个好的工作 , 也节省大家在网上搜索资料的时间来学习 。
- word怎么设置首行缩进两个字符 首行缩进2cm的设置
- 文档正文首行缩进2字符怎么弄 word首行缩进在哪里设置
- 缺少标识符字符串或数字怎么回事 网页上有错误不跳转怎么办
- python字典转json字符串 json在线格式转换方法
- windows安装mysql的步骤和方法 mysql客户端安装教程
- java排列组合工具类 java字符串排列组合算法
- mysql镜像文件怎么安装 镜像文件安装系统教程
- 深入理解mysqld:MySQL数据库服务的核心组件
- SQL索引优化指南:创建和使用策略提高查询性能
- MySQL索引管理实践:如何正确删除索引?